A Stochastic Multi-layer Algorithm for Semi-Discrete Optimal Transport with Applications to Texture Synthesis and Style Transfer - Archive ouverte HAL Accéder directement au contenu
Article Dans Une Revue Journal of Mathematical Imaging and Vision Année : 2020

A Stochastic Multi-layer Algorithm for Semi-Discrete Optimal Transport with Applications to Texture Synthesis and Style Transfer

Arthur Leclaire
Julien Rabin

Résumé

This paper investigates a new stochastic algorithm to approximate semi-discrete optimal transport for large-scale problem, i.e. in high dimension and for a large number of points. The proposed technique relies on a hierarchical decomposition of the target discrete distribution and the transport map itself. A stochastic optimization algorithm is derived to estimate the parameters of the corresponding multi-layer weighted nearest neighbor model. This model allows for fast evaluation during synthesis and training, for which it exhibits faster empirical convergence. Several applications to patch-based image processing are investigated: texture synthesis, texture inpainting, and style transfer. The proposed models compare favorably to the state of the art, either in terms of image quality, computation time, or regarding the number of parameters. Additionally, they do not require any pixel-based optimization or training on a large dataset of natural images.
Fichier principal
Vignette du fichier
revised.pdf (104.16 Mo) Télécharger le fichier
Origine : Fichiers produits par l'(les) auteur(s)

Dates et versions

hal-02331068 , version 1 (24-10-2019)
hal-02331068 , version 2 (22-06-2020)

Identifiants

Citer

Arthur Leclaire, Julien Rabin. A Stochastic Multi-layer Algorithm for Semi-Discrete Optimal Transport with Applications to Texture Synthesis and Style Transfer. Journal of Mathematical Imaging and Vision, 2020, 63, pp.282-308. ⟨10.1007/s10851-020-00975-4⟩. ⟨hal-02331068v2⟩
352 Consultations
40 Téléchargements

Altmetric

Partager

Gmail Facebook X LinkedIn More